首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将弹出式窗口的居中位置固定在旋转位置

要将弹出式窗口的居中位置固定在旋转位置,可以使用以下步骤:

  1. 使用HTML、CSS和JavaScript创建弹出式窗口的界面和功能。可以使用HTML和CSS定义窗口的样式和布局,并使用JavaScript实现窗口的弹出和关闭功能。
  2. 使用CSS的transform属性对弹出式窗口进行旋转操作。通过设置transform属性的rotate值,可以实现窗口的旋转效果。例如,可以使用transform: rotate(45deg);将窗口顺时针旋转45度。
  3. 使用JavaScript获取弹出式窗口的宽度和高度。可以使用window.innerWidth获取窗口的宽度,使用window.innerHeight获取窗口的高度。
  4. 使用JavaScript计算旋转后的弹出式窗口的新位置。根据旋转角度和窗口的宽度、高度,可以计算出旋转后窗口的新位置。可以使用以下公式进行计算:
代码语言:txt
复制
newLeft = (window.innerWidth - windowWidth) / 2;
newTop = (window.innerHeight - windowHeight) / 2;

其中,windowWidthwindowHeight分别是弹出式窗口的宽度和高度。

  1. 使用JavaScript将弹出式窗口移动到新位置。可以使用DOM操作,通过设置窗口的left和top样式属性,将窗口移动到新位置。例如,可以使用以下代码将窗口移动到新位置:
代码语言:txt
复制
popup.style.left = newLeft + 'px';
popup.style.top = newTop + 'px';

其中,popup是表示弹出式窗口的DOM元素。

推荐腾讯云相关产品:腾讯云服务器(https://cloud.tencent.com/product/cvm)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券